Обзор книги Коренные народы в условиях глобализации

В книге «Культуры коренных народов в взаимосвязанном мире» (Indigenous Cultures in an Interconnected World) 14 ученых со всего мира раскрывают, как коренные сообщества блестяще используют технологии для сохранения своей идентичности в условиях глобализации. Как народу Инну под руководством Даниэля Ашини удалось превратить культурный активизм в мощный инструмент борьбы против современного колониализма?

Об авторе

Об авторе книги Коренные народы в условиях глобализации

Клэр Смит и Грэм К. Уорд, соредакторы книги Indigenous Cultures in an Interconnected World («Коренные культуры в взаимосвязанном мире»), являются уважаемыми учеными в области антропологии и исследований коренных народов.

Смит, профессор археологии в Университете Флиндерса и бывший президент Всемирного археологического конгресса, обладает многолетним опытом полевых работ с общинами австралийских аборигенов, особенно в Арнем-Ленде.

Уорд, антрополог и бывший заместитель директора Австралийского института исследований аборигенов и жителей островов Торресова пролива, вносит свой вклад в качестве эксперта в области культурной политики и сохранения наследия. Их совместная работа рассматривает двойственную роль глобализации как угрозы и возможности для коренных сообществ, объединяя тематические исследования от Латинской Америки до Тасмании.

Дополнительные публикации Смит, включая Global Social Archaeologies и The Archaeologist’s Field Handbook, укрепляют ее авторитет в вопросах деколонизации академических методологий.

Впервые опубликованный в 2000 году и переизданный в 2020 году, их междисциплинарный анализ остается основным элементом университетских программ, получая признание за баланс между академической строгостью и практическими выводами для защиты культурных прав.
